The following table describes the labels in this screen. 
Table 103   Advanced Application > PPPoE > Intermediate Agent > VLAN
LABEL DESCRIPTION
Show VLAN  Use this section to specify the VLANs you want to configure in the section 
below.
Start VID Enter the lowest VLAN ID you want to configure in the section below.
End VID Enter the highest VLAN ID you want to configure in the section below.
Apply Click Apply to display the specified range of VLANs in the section below.
VID This field displays the VLAN ID of each VLAN in the range specified above. 
If you configure the * VLAN, the settings are applied to all VLANs.
* Use this row to make the setting the same for all VLANs. Use this row first 
and then make adjustments on a VLAN-by-VLAN basis. 
Note: Changes in this row are copied to all the VLANs as soon as 
you make them.
Enabled Select this option to turn on the PPPoE Intermediate Agent on a VLAN.
Circuit-id  Select this option to make the Circuit ID settings for a specific VLAN take 
effect.
Remote-id  Select this option to make the Remote ID settings for a specific VLAN take 
effect.
Apply Click Apply to save your changes to the Switch’s run-time memory. The 
Switch loses these changes if it is turned off or loses power, so use the 
Save link on the top navigation panel to save your changes to the non-
volatile memory when you are done configuring.
Cancel Click Cancel to begin configuring this screen afresh.
